Luciana Littizzetto questioned the law with irritation, asking, "Please someone explain to me how this is a crime?" highlighting the public's confusion regarding the legislation's justification.
Elly Schlein condemned the law as "atrocious propaganda at the expense of children," positioning it not merely as a political tool but as an affront to societal values.
Arcigay criticized the legislation, calling it a "grave negation of individual rights" and pledged to protest, indicating strong opposition from Italy's LGBTQ+ community.
Despite the widespread disapproval from progressives, the law was quickly overshadowed by other news, demonstrating how contentious issues can fail to maintain public attention.
